Our good friend, Bettina Bacani-Cheung of BettinaBacani.com, is showing everyone how to properly start off a Meat Plus EATSperience. First, get a table number right when you’re about to enter. You will use this number when ordering.

meat-plus-cafe-sm-mall-of-asia

Next, you may choose your own Steak! When we dropped by, Meat Plus had Ribeye, Porterhouse, and NY Strip. All steak cuts are portioned differently, make sure to choose wisely.

meat-plus-cafe-sm-mall-of-asia

Here’s what’s inside the freezer! They have burger patties for burger steaks, too. We chose the Ribeye right away because of its perfect meat and fat ratio!

meat-plus-cafe-sm-mall-of-asia

Once you’re done choosing your steak, it’s time to approach the counter to order some more and pay for your meal! Here, you may choose other Meat Plus offerings. They have burgers, spaghetti, roast beef, meat platters, sides, desserts, and drinks. TIP: Never miss their desserts! Every single thing is so good!

meat-plus-cafe-sm-mall-of-asia

After ordering, time to choose your table! This is what the ground floor dining area looks like. They also have a dining area outside the restaurant and one on the second floor. Each table has its own set of cutleries and condiments, it’s the wooden piggy just in case you don’t see it.

meat-plus-cafe-sm-mall-of-asia

Although Meat Plus Café has servers, a huge part of the dining EATSperience here is the self-service side of things. As you can see from the photo above, they have a condiments and water station in which diners may get ice-cold water, tissue, and all sorts of sauces.

Potato Skin (Php 75)

We might be wrong on this one or not but we just couldn’t believe that this huge plate of crispy fried potato goodness is just 75 pesos! Unbelievable, right? It’s soooooo good! The two dips were great, too! Cheese and Sour Cream. If you will be going to Meat Plus Café anytime soon, make sure to order this side! You will surely love it!!!

Meat Plus Burger and Fries (Php 295)

Yup, the Meat Plus Burger is a double patty cheeseburger! As you can see from the photo above, it’s EXTREMELY JUICY! The cook on the patties was perfection. The number of fries on the side was pretty awesome, too. This burger meal for 295 pesos? Definitely, value for money EATSperience at Meat Plus!

Meat Platter A – Pork Chops, Pork BBQ Ribs, Roast Beef, and Grilled Chicken with 5 cups of rice, 5 drinks, 1 kernel corn and 1 mixed veggies (Php 1,400)

Another menu item that will surely blow your mind, Meat Plus Café’s Meat Platters! This one’s just the Meat Platter A at 1,400 pesos and it looks like it can feed an army. All the favorite meats in one humongous platter with rice, sides, and drinks. Hands down one of the most “sulit” family-sized meals ever. Our favorite here is the Pork BBQ Ribs and Roast Beef. Super tender and extremely tasty! Awesome job, Meat Plus!

US Ribeye (priced at approximately Php 665 according to its weight and plus Php 155 for the cooking fee per steak)

It’s as good as we expected it to be! The Ribeye is really one of the best if not the best cuts of steak ever. The layers of fat and meat just give a buttery bite each and every single time. The meat was cooked perfectly at medium rare, too! A super tender and flavorful cut of steak. Nothing but awesomeness, Meat Plus!

Meat Plus Café

Ground Floor, Entertainment Mall, SM Mall of Asia, Mall of Asia Complex (MOA), Pasay City

Facebook / Instagram

Budget: 1000 php for two
